Damaged/broken fob mechanism

There are many ways to repair your key fob. Common issues include physical wear and tear, water damage and a battery not functioning correctly.

A dead battery is the main cause of a key FOB not working. It can be fixed by replacing the battery or purchasing another one. You can find replacement batteries at your local auto parts shop or big box stores. After you have purchased a new battery, you can begin using the key FOB.

A damaged battery connector is a common issue in key FOBs. These are easy to identify because the terminals feel loose. It is possible to fix the key FOB by resoldering them.

If the car battery isn't working, you may require reprogramming the system. This can be accomplished by mechanics or an auto locksmith. An owner's manual can also assist.

It is a good idea for you to examine the battery if your key isn't functioning. Most often, this is one of the most frequent reasons for car keys to fail. It is also a relatively easy issue to fix.

Wear and tear is click here a different issue that can affect your key. After a long time of use, the contacts on the key fob might wear. The most effective way to repair this is to clean the pads using alcohol and cotton swabs. Dry them before putting them back together.

There are also electrical and mechanical problems that could occur with your car keys. They usually involve battery connector terminals. They can loosen and you may have to fix them by soldering them back into the correct position.
